Setuid/suid handled processes (rpcbind, ns-slapd and others) do not generate a core dump file after a crash
Issue
- The rpcbind service crashed but no core was generated
- The slapd service crashed but no core was generated as well
- ns-slapd on a Red Hat Directory Server or a Red Hat Identity Management server crashes but this event is not picked up by abrt
- One of the following errors is logged in
/var/log/messages:
kernel: rpcbind[xxxx] general protection ip:7fa27957df72 sp:7fff5983adf0 error:0 in libc-2.12.so[7fa279508000+18a000]
Or
kernel: ns-slapd[xxxxx]: segfault at 2929296d6f5b ip 0000003af3a7b53c sp 00007ff345feaa08 error 4 in libc-2.12.so[3af3a00000+18a000]
Environment
- Red Hat Enterprise Linux 6 and 7
- (Optional) Red Hat Directory Server or Red Hat Identity Management
